The quick answer
In 2026, marriage counseling typically costs $100 to $300 per session nationally, with an average near $165. In higher cost areas like New York City, most couples pay $200 to $350 per session with a licensed therapist, and specialists with advanced training charge more.

Per session vs. per hour : the distinction that trips people up
A lot of couples search "marriage counseling cost per hour" and get confused. Here's why: therapists bill by the session, not the hour. And a session might be 45, 50, 60, or 90 minutes.
So a $250 fee tells you almost nothing until you know the length. A $250 seventy five minute session and a $250 fifty minute session are very different value. Always ask: what's the fee, and how long is the session?
Common Mistake Comparing two therapists purely on the headline number. A slightly higher fee for a longer session : or for a therapist with real couples training : is often the better deal. Price per minute of genuinely skilled couples work is the number that matters.
What you'll pay with insurance
Most plans don't cover marriage counseling as a standalone service, because "relationship distress" isn't, on its own, a billable diagnosis. But there are two real paths to coverage:
In network, when one partner has a diagnosable condition : sessions billed under CPT code 90847 can drop your cost to a 20–50 copay.
Out of network superbills : you pay full fee, submit an itemized receipt, and recover a portion (often 50–80%) if your plan has out of network behavioral health benefits.

What you'll pay without insurance
Private pay is the reality for many couples, since a lot of skilled couples therapists are out of network by choice. Without insurance, expect the 100–300 national range (200–350 in NYC), before any sliding scale or telehealth savings.
Private pay isn't all downside: you can choose any therapist, unrestricted by networks, and you skip putting a diagnosis on anyone's permanent record.
Did You Know? Because telehealth practices don't carry office rent overhead, an online marriage counselor with the same credentials as a boutique in person therapist often charges less. You're paying for the expertise, not the address.
How to lower the cost
Ask about sliding scale : income based slots (50–150) exist but are rarely advertised.
Use out of network benefits : a $250 session reimbursed at 60% nets closer to $100.
Check your employer's EAP : sometimes 3–8 free, confidential sessions.
Choose telehealth to cut office overhead pricing.
Prioritize fit : the costliest counseling is the kind you abandon after three sessions with the wrong therapist.

Is marriage counseling cheaper than couples therapy?
They're the same service under different names, so the fees are identical. Any price difference comes from the therapist, location, and session length : not the label.
Is marriage counseling billed per hour or per session?
Per session. Sessions range from 45 to 90 minutes, so always confirm both the fee and the length before comparing therapists.
Does insurance make marriage counseling cheaper?
It can. In network billing under CPT code 90847 (when one partner has a qualifying diagnosis) can reduce your cost to a copay, and out of network superbills can recover part of the fee.
